Output f04e08402bd185f78fd7ddbf4a70d5637f0af267f04783e5cdc95326374d6f9e:145

value
692453
script pubkey
OP_0 OP_PUSHBYTES_32 17ae57fcfe1f5d1c0ede87f4b0b0b8f668a39aa306579374d352bb1b7d5323df
address
bc1qz7h90l87raw3crk7sl6tpv9c7e528x4rqetexaxn22a3kl2ny00slwhlwa
transaction
f04e08402bd185f78fd7ddbf4a70d5637f0af267f04783e5cdc95326374d6f9e
spent
true